The Advantages Of Cryogenic Flexible Hose

cryogenic flexible hoses are a crucial component in many industries where cryogenic temperatures are a necessity. These hoses are specially designed to handle extremely low temperatures while still maintaining their flexibility and durability. In this article, we will discuss the advantages of cryogenic flexible hoses and why they are an essential tool for industries such as pharmaceuticals, aerospace, and food processing.

cryogenic flexible hoses are designed to transport cryogenic fluids such as liquid nitrogen, helium, and oxygen. These hoses are constructed using specialized materials that can withstand temperatures as low as -200 degrees Celsius (-328 degrees Fahrenheit). The materials used in cryogenic flexible hoses are carefully chosen to ensure that they do not become brittle or crack under extreme cold temperatures.

One of the primary advantages of cryogenic flexible hoses is their flexibility. These hoses can be bent and maneuvered without losing their structural integrity, making them incredibly versatile. This flexibility is essential in industries where precise and controlled movement of cryogenic fluids is necessary. Whether it’s transferring liquid nitrogen in a laboratory setting or refueling a spacecraft in aerospace applications, cryogenic flexible hoses provide the flexibility needed to get the job done.

In addition to their flexibility, cryogenic flexible hoses are also extremely durable. These hoses are designed to withstand harsh operating conditions, including exposure to extreme cold temperatures and high pressures. The materials used in cryogenic flexible hoses are resistant to cracking, tearing, and other forms of damage that can occur in cryogenic environments. This durability ensures that cryogenic flexible hoses have a long service life and can withstand the rigors of daily use.

Another advantage of cryogenic flexible hoses is their safety features. These hoses are designed to prevent leaks and spills of cryogenic fluids, protecting both workers and equipment from potential hazards. cryogenic flexible hoses are constructed with multiple layers of insulation and protective sheathing to contain the cryogenic fluids and prevent them from escaping. This not only ensures the safety of personnel working with cryogenic fluids but also protects the environment from potential contamination.

Furthermore, cryogenic flexible hoses are easy to install and maintain. These hoses can be quickly connected and disconnected from cryogenic systems, reducing downtime and increasing efficiency. Additionally, cryogenic flexible hoses require minimal maintenance, saving time and resources for businesses that rely on cryogenic fluids for their operations. This ease of installation and maintenance makes cryogenic flexible hoses a cost-effective solution for industries that require cryogenic fluid transport.

In industries such as pharmaceuticals, cryogenic flexible hoses are essential for transporting and storing cryogenic fluids used in medical applications. Liquid nitrogen, for example, is commonly used in cryopreservation and cryosurgery procedures. Cryogenic flexible hoses ensure that these valuable cryogenic fluids are safely transported and delivered to where they are needed, without the risk of contamination or leaks.

Aerospace is another industry that relies heavily on cryogenic flexible hoses for refueling spacecraft and other cryogenic applications. These hoses enable precise and controlled transfer of cryogenic fluids, ensuring that spacecraft are refueled safely and efficiently. The flexibility and durability of cryogenic flexible hoses make them an ideal choice for aerospace applications where reliability and safety are paramount.

In the food processing industry, cryogenic flexible hoses are used for quick freezing and chilling of food products. These hoses allow for rapid and uniform cooling of food items, preserving their quality and freshness. Cryogenic flexible hoses ensure that food products are processed safely and efficiently, meeting industry standards and regulations for food safety.
